    By Bernadette Heier Verified| Food On Demand@ Chipotle founder Steve Ells is no stranger to shaking things up. His latest venture, Kernel Foods, has just undergone a major makeover. Now rebranded as Counter Service, the New York-based startup has shifted gears to an artisanal, “mostly sandwich” concept. The original Kernel setup offered a plant-based menu and leaned heavily on automation. A custom robotic arm dropped plant-based patties into high-speed ovens, while a centralized kitchen prepped ingredient offsite. But it didn’t quite click.

    By Bernadette Heier Verified, Outstanding Operators| Food On Demand@ Playa Bowls is a Food On Demand Outstanding Operator. Founded by avid surfers Robert Giuliani and Abby Taylor, the brand was inspired by their surf trips to places like Panama, Costa Rica, and Hawaii. There, they discovered unique versions of acai and pitaya bowls. Wanting to bring a taste of these vibrant bowls to the Jersey Shore, the two launched a humble pop-up stand. As word spread, their business began to rapidly grow.

Franchise Times is a prominent publication in the franchising industry, established in 1988 and based in Minnesota, United States. The company specializes in book and periodical publishing, focusing on delivering news and information relevant to franchisors, franchisees, and businesses in the franchise sector. It is well-known for its award-winning print magazine and digital content that serves a diverse audience of business professionals. The magazine covers a range of topics, including financing, real estate, human resources, and legal issues affecting the franchising landscape. In addition to the print publication, Franchise Times provides digital content that offers insights and updates on industry trends. The company also profiles successful franchisees and franchisors, sharing valuable experiences and lessons from the field.
